To prevent loss of hair, start putting more protein in your diet. Hair is made out of protein. You can get protein by eating fish, poultry, eggs and red meat. If meat is not your thing, you could replace the meats with lentils and kidney beans to get the needed protein. Protein and iron in your diet will promote hair growth.
Vitamin C
Vitamin C plays a significant role in preventing loss of hair. Collagen plays a vital role in keeping hair alive and healthy. Vitamin C can aid in proper production of collagen. You can increase your intake of vitamin C by consuming citrus fruits or candy drops with vitamin C.

Wet Hair
Take care to avoid brushing hair that is wet, or even damp. Wet hair is susceptible to damage. Brush your hair once it is dry to avoid damaging it. The brushing of wet hair might result in frizzy hair and split ends.

Scalp Massage
Massage your scalp often to stimulate nerves and circulation. Scalp massage is highly effective in promoting hair growth, due to the fact that it manages anxiety that may be related to thinning hair for some people. There is no danger to scalp massage, so you can do it daily.
